We were down at the CR last Friday and KILLED the rainbow up by the dam on light spinning tackle and blue foxes. The river was running at 9480, high, and all the sandbars were submerged, but it didn't matter. We also took a 19" brown (almost 20"!) and numerous 12" brown. The smaller fish were very aggressive. Did not try any fly fishing- too much current. Fish bit better while it was raining and nasty.
